QUOTE(Ah hao @ Jan 8 2011, 06:49 PM) Wanna ask all white colour owner, the white colour will turn yellowish after some periods ?? my sis gonna buy one, but she scared white color turn yellow... It's not like that at all. Even black colors can turn greyish, or red to dull red if you don't take care of your car. Just wash the car when it's dirty, don't let the dirt gather on your car as it eats the paint. And polish the car once in 6 months or once a year also can, depending on your love for the car thanks in advance |

the purpose of having LED daytime running light is to have it on automatically during daytime, not blinding others with its full brightness during night time...
the full brightness can really blind other drivers during night time if its not dimmed or switched off hope you guys understand that =) |
